LOS ANGELES (AP) — Matthew Stafford practiced with the Los Angeles Rams on Monday, marking the quarterback’s first workout with the team this preseason after having been unable to do so because of a sore back .

Stafford, 37, took first-team reps during the session and did not speak to reporters afterward. Coach Sean McVay said it was too soon to know what the session means for Stafford’s status going forward.

“I think that would be putting the cart way before the horse,” McVay said. “I thought he did a good job today, and we had 26 plays of team (with Stafford), and (he) did a really nice job of managing the huddle. I thought he saw the field well. I thought he went where the balls would go, and there’s some good competitive work on both sides today.”
